4 available 4 • View allPersonal Status Law for Non-Muslim Foreigners in the Emirate of Abu Dhabi 8
A new civil personal status decree has been introduced in the emirate of Abu Dhabi by His Highness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an, President of the UAE and the Ruler of Abu Dhabi. This personal status decree will be applicable for non-Muslim foreigners based in Abu Dhabi in matters of marriage, divorce, Will, inheritance, and custody of children.

Joint Custody in the UAE Civil Personal Status for Non-Muslims 1
Joint Custody in UAE Law Article 10 of the Federal Decree Law No. 41 of 2022 on Civil Personal Status for Non-Muslims shines a spotlight on the significance of Shared custody following divorce. This article recognizes joint and equal custody as a right for both the father and mother post-separation or divorce.

1 available 1 • View allFederal Law No. (28) of 2005 On Personal Status 24
UAE Personal Status Law (also known as Personal Affairs Law) governs marriage, divorce, inheritance and other personal affairs in the United Arab Emirates. The law equally applies to citizens of the UAE and non-citizens unless one of them asks for the application of his home country law.
